TEIN EDFC feedback
The sound of controlling the damping force from the driver seat is too convenient. What effect will the EDFC as oftently used and the fact thats electonically controlled do.? Contoller failure.? Buttons malfuntion.?

The electronics are solid state, so it's dependent on the robustness of the electrical components.
I'd worry about the stepper motors, since these are notorious for failure.

I have the EDFC on my car with a set of Tein Flex coilovers. Yes, the stepper motors clear the hood just fine. I have yet to drive the car and fiddle with it though. When the key is turned the stepper motors turn on and you can hear them recalibrate themselves. The EDFC control unit itself does not have any *****, only buttons. I have pics in my buildup thread. Very soon I'll have some video of the operation of the unit as well.
The only part of the EDFC system that I see breaking are the stepper motors. I don't see the control box breaking unless for some reason your pushing the buttins with a screwdriver or a hammer or there is just some defect on the PCB.
